You can set the home page to about:home or any other page by dragging the tab with the page on the toolbar Home button and confirm.

See also:

   Tools > Options > General > Startup: Home page

You can check the target line in the Firefox desktop shortcut (right-click: Properties) to make sure that nothing is appended after the path to the Firefox program.


You can use the SearchReset extension to reset some preferences to the default values.

Note that the SearchReset extension only runs once and then uninstalls automatically, so it won't show on the "Firefox > Add-ons" page (about:addons).
